The Core Problem: Defective Collagen

At the heart of what happens to the body during scurvy is the crucial role of vitamin C, or ascorbic acid, in producing collagen. Collagen is the most abundant protein in the body, a foundational component of connective tissues such as skin, blood vessels, bones, and cartilage. When dietary vitamin C is severely lacking for one to three months, the body cannot properly synthesize and stabilize the triple-helix structure of collagen. The resulting weak and dysfunctional collagen affects nearly every system in the body, leading to the varied and severe symptoms of scurvy.

The Symptom Progression

Scurvy symptoms develop in stages, often beginning with non-specific signs and progressing to severe systemic manifestations if left untreated.

Early Stage Symptoms

  • Fatigue and weakness: Often the first and most common signs, resulting from impaired energy metabolism.
  • Irritability and malaise: Emotional changes and a general feeling of being unwell can occur before more visible physical symptoms appear.
  • Aching limbs: Muscular and joint pain, particularly in the legs, may develop.
  • Anorexia and weight loss: A decrease in appetite can contribute to malnutrition and further deficiency.

Advanced Stage Manifestations

  • Hemorrhagic signs: Due to fragile blood vessels, internal bleeding becomes a major issue. This includes:
    • Petechiae: Small, pinpoint red or blue spots under the skin, often first seen on the lower extremities.
    • Ecchymoses: Larger, dark, and easily formed bruises.
    • Perifollicular hemorrhages: Bleeding around hair follicles, where hairs may become coiled or corkscrew-shaped.
    • Internal bleeding: Potential for hemorrhage in organs, joints (hemarthroses), and muscles.
  • Oral health problems: The gums become swollen, spongy, purple, and bleed easily. Eventually, teeth may loosen and fall out as the connective tissue that holds them in place deteriorates.
  • Impaired wound healing: Old wounds may reopen, and new ones fail to heal due to the absence of robust collagen formation.
  • Skin and hair changes: Skin becomes dry, rough, and scaly. Hair may become brittle and break easily.
  • Anemia: Scurvy can cause anemia through several mechanisms, including blood loss from hemorrhages, impaired iron absorption (vitamin C facilitates this process), and potential folate deficiency.

Critical and Fatal Complications

In severe, untreated scurvy, the body's systems continue to fail, leading to life-threatening conditions. This can include generalized edema, severe jaundice, neuropathy, convulsions, and eventually death from infection or major internal bleeding, such as a cerebral hemorrhage.

Comparison of Scurvy Stages

Symptom Category Early Stage (approx. 1-3 months) Late Stage (untreated progression)
General Fatigue, weakness, malaise, irritability, lethargy Severe weakness, generalized edema, jaundice, fever, convulsions
Musculoskeletal Vague aches and pains in arms and legs, joint pain Excruciating bone and joint pain, subperiosteal hemorrhages, pseudoparalysis
Skin & Hair Rough, scaly skin, easy bruising Perifollicular hemorrhages, ecchymoses, corkscrew hairs, poor wound healing, reopening of old scars
Oral Mild gingivitis Swollen, purple, and bleeding gums, gum necrosis, loose teeth, eventual tooth loss
Vascular Increased capillary fragility, minor petechiae Profound bleeding under the skin and into joints and organs, anemia

The Widespread Impact on Body Systems

Beyond the visible symptoms, scurvy's systemic effects demonstrate how vital vitamin C is for multiple bodily functions.

The Musculoskeletal System

Collagen is a critical component of bone structure. Without adequate vitamin C, new bone formation is impaired, and existing bone becomes more fragile. This can lead to microscopic fractures and, in severe cases, larger fractures and dislocations. Subperiosteal hemorrhage (bleeding beneath the bone's membrane) can cause immense pain and tenderness, particularly in the legs. This is especially debilitating for infants, who may assume a characteristic 'frog-leg' posture due to the pain.

The Cardiovascular System

Due to weak and fragile blood vessels, the vascular system is significantly compromised. This leads to the characteristic bruising and petechiae. In severe cases, bleeding can occur into the heart muscle itself or the pericardial space, which can be fatal. Impaired vascular function can also contribute to low blood pressure.

The Immune System

Vitamin C acts as an antioxidant and is important for immune function. Deficiency can compromise the immune system, making individuals more susceptible to infections and further delaying wound healing. White blood cells, in particular, accumulate high concentrations of vitamin C.

The Nervous System

Vitamin C is a cofactor for the synthesis of neurotransmitters like norepinephrine. Lack of this vitamin can lead to mood changes, lethargy, and in advanced stages, potential neuropathy and convulsions.

How to Reverse and Prevent Scurvy

Reversing scurvy requires replenishing vitamin C stores, typically through supplements and a diet rich in fruits and vegetables. Symptoms like fatigue and malaise can improve within 24 to 48 hours, while gum and skin issues may take weeks or months to heal. For prevention, a balanced diet is key. Here are some excellent sources of vitamin C to include in your diet:

  • Citrus Fruits: Oranges, grapefruits, lemons
  • Berries: Strawberries, kiwi fruit, blackcurrants
  • Vegetables: Broccoli, bell peppers, Brussels sprouts, cabbage
  • Other sources: Tomatoes, potatoes, cantaloupe, parsley

For most people, incorporating fresh, uncooked fruits and vegetables provides sufficient vitamin C, as cooking can reduce its content. Those with risk factors like restrictive diets, alcoholism, or certain health conditions should be particularly vigilant about their intake.
